Overview
The Facilities Project Manager – Technical serves as the senior technical authority for assigned projects and is responsible for ensuring that all engineering deliverables meet operational requirements, project expectations, and applicable codes and standards.
As a Facilities Project Manager – Technical, you’ll support technical decision‑making, coordinate with designers and builders, and help drive designs from concept through construction. This role is ideal for early‑career engineers looking to grow quickly into technical leadership.
Key Responsibilities:
- Coordinate engineering support across structural, mechanical, electrical, and waterfront disciplines.
- Act as the key technical link between engineering, planning, and third party shipyard construction teams.
- Support design reviews to verify constructibilityand compliance with standards.
- Maintain configuration control, documentation, and design history throughout the project.
- Work directly with ocean asset operators and end‑users to ensure requirements are captured and delivered.
- Assist in verifying that as‑built configurations meet approved design intent.
